Venue Image
Venue Image

Venue Information

Bar. Light-filled tavern with floor-to-ceiling windows, cocktails & a terrace with river & city vistas. Service options: Dine-in · No takeaway · No delivery Located in: The Wharf DC

Upcoming Events (0)

You might also like (0)